WWE megastar The Undertaker (real name Mark Calaway) has rarely been inside a WWE ring of late. For the past several years, he only wrestles at the annual Wrestlemania event, due to a series of injuries over the years which have affected his body. After his loss to Brock Lesnar at Wrestlemania 30, ending his 'streak' at 21 wins, it is also unclear whether Undertaker would ever return to a WWE ring.

Now, there has been an outpouring of concern for Undertaker’s health after Limp Bizkit frontman Fred Durst dedicated a song to the wrestler on Saturday evening.

"This next song goes out to our friend Mark Calaway, The Undertaker. He’s not doing real well right now and we want all our fans to keep him in their thoughts and prayers," the rocker said.

Undertaker's wife Michelle McCool, who once also wrestled in WWE under the same name, has denied the rumours. She posted a picture of Undertaker with her on Instagram to quell the rumours. 

However, Undertaker certainly looks pale and quite thin in this picture, unlike what we are used to seeing over the years. A few years ago, a picture of a bald, thin Undertaker sparked rumours that he had cancer, but those have been brushed away by his friends and family, and never confirmed.

 

Brock Lesnar looks sick at WWE Night of Champions

WWE World Heavyweight Champion and former Mixed Martial Arts champion Brock Lesnar retained his WWE title at the company's Night of Champions event on Sunday, against John Cena. However, many viewers noticed that Lesnar looked pale, red in the face and out of breath during the match. In fact, he looked ill within the first three minutes of the match itself.

Though Lesnar usually has a pale look on his face, he has been an MMA champion. MMA is a form of legitimate wrestling which involves much greater physical exertion than the scripted matches in the WWE. It is therefore surprising that Lesnar found himself in such a state on Sunday night. He also looked to be moving around slower than he usually does.

WWE Hall of Fame inductee The Ultimate Warrior, who was during the early 1990s one of the company's top stars, died of a heart attack the night after Wrestlemania 30. He had looked pale and similarly out of breath during his Hall of Fame speech the previous night. 

Therefore, WWE fans are quite worried about Lesnar. Lesnar had severe diverticulitis in 2009 and 2011 which forced him to quit the MMA. Besides, professional wrestling has a history of wrestlers dying at a young age due to cardiac arrest. Most of these wrestlers were into some form of drug abuse. While WWE's present Wellness policy prohibits the use of several drugs and regularly tests wrestlers, it is not known if Brock Lesnar can also be tested, given that he only has a part time contract with specified dates.
